Either of the two atomizers with velocity style posts (two posts) is about the easiest, or an atty with a postless deck. Google the "Velocity dripper" youtube tutorials.

That being said, I will give you advice on what to use when building a coil.
I am not a fan of Temp Control.
I like my watts pure and simple
IMHO, 24 AWG Kanthal is the best.
I can wrap a coil using it, and if I dry burn the coil and put in a new wick every two tanks, the coil will last me for around 60 days.

Best I can say is it takes practice. Get some wire off Amazon or e bay for $5 for 100 feet, I use 26 gauge and it's later me almost 2 years. You'll also need some clippers, you can use finger nail clippers but you can find some decent wire clippers online too. The next thing you'll need is cotton. I like cotton bacon cause you get a lot and it's easy to use.Would like to get into building but have no clue what to start with or even what to do.
